"Look how tired this Mommy is Tired and frumpy Grouchy chumpy Oh, what a grump!" Then, for contrast, "Look at Baby Smart, good Baby Happy Baby." Baby loves to make gravy out of applesauce and ketchup and, when it's just right -- not too lumpy, not too bumpy -- suddenly, DUMP! It goes on Baby's head. Will Baby take a nap now? Mommy puts Baby gently into the crib. But when Mommy starts to tiptoe out, Baby cries and whimpers, cries and whimpers. So Mommy reads to Baby -- and reads and reads until...guess what! The surprise ending of this beguiling picture book will delight the very young -- and their tired but loving mothers. Janet Wong, a well-known poet, reflects on not only her own but every mother's experience in her rollicking rhyme. The bright watercolors of John Wallace, an English artist whose work is published both in the United Kingdom and the United States, complement the text to perfection.
